There's a category of pantry items that nobody talks about but everyone quietly relies on. Worcestershire sauce. Fish sauce. A tube of tomato paste. ReaLime 100% Lime Juice belongs in that same drawer — unglamorous, consistently useful, and easy to underestimate until you run out.
The case for bottled lime juice isn't complicated. Fresh limes vary enormously in juice yield depending on season, origin, and how long they've been in transit. A recipe calling for two tablespoons of lime juice might require one lime or three, and you often don't know until you're already mid-prep. ReaLime standardizes that. One tablespoon from the bottle is one tablespoon of consistent, measurable acidity, every time.
For home bartenders, this matters more than it might seem. A well-made margarita or daiquiri is a ratio-driven drink. The citrus component needs to be predictable to dial in a recipe you can repeat. ReaLime, sourced from 100% lime juice, delivers that repeatability without requiring a citrus press and a pile of fruit on the counter every time you want to make a round of drinks.
Cooking applications are equally strong. Marinades, vinaigrettes, salsas, and finishing acids all benefit from the clean tartness ReaLime provides. It integrates smoothly into sauces where fresh lime might add unwanted pulp or inconsistent flavor. The flip-top bottle makes it easy to add a measured squeeze directly into a pan or bowl without stopping to cut and juice fruit.
The honest limitation is aromatic complexity. Fresh lime peel carries volatile oils that contribute brightness and fragrance beyond what juice alone provides. For a ceviche where lime is the central flavor, or a dish finished tableside, fresh is still the right call. But for the other ninety percent of uses — the weeknight cooking, the casual cocktail, the quick marinade — ReaLime is the practical, well-priced answer that earns its place in the fridge every single week.
